Revert "ACPICA: revert "acpi_serialize" changes"

This reverts commit a8f4af6dc6.
Thus restoring ACPICA's new acpi_serialize code.

This commit by itself may cause a regression, but
it is reverted in this order so that subsequent
reverts reverts under this one can be made
without conflict.

Signed-off-by: Len Brown <len.brown@intel.com>

/*******************************************************************************
*
* FUNCTION: acpi_ex_relinquish_interpreter
*
* PARAMETERS: None
*
* RETURN: None
*
* DESCRIPTION: Exit the interpreter execution region, from within the
* interpreter - before attempting an operation that will possibly
* block the running thread.
*
* Cases where the interpreter is unlocked internally
* 1) Method to be blocked on a Sleep() AML opcode
* 2) Method to be blocked on an Acquire() AML opcode
* 3) Method to be blocked on a Wait() AML opcode
* 4) Method to be blocked to acquire the global lock
* 5) Method to be blocked waiting to execute a serialized control method
* that is currently executing
* 6) About to invoke a user-installed opregion handler
*
******************************************************************************/
void acpi_ex_relinquish_interpreter(void)
{
ACPI_FUNCTION_TRACE(ex_relinquish_interpreter);
/*
* If the global serialized flag is set, do not release the interpreter.
* This forces the interpreter to be single threaded.
*/
if (!acpi_gbl_all_methods_serialized) {
acpi_ex_exit_interpreter();
}
return_VOID;
